C++ knihovna pro práci s čísly v pohyblivé řádové čárce s libovolnou přesností / C++ Arbitrary Precision Floating Point Library

This thesis deals with the design of a floating point module, which allows to perform operations with floating point operands that have any bit width. For this purpose, the module is implemented as a template class in C ++. The module is designed to allow it to be used when designing an application-specific processor. First, the floating point number and template functions in c ++ are described. In the practical part the algorithms of the individual operations and the design of the module itself are described as template libraries.
